I have been watching this thread, and I have 3 questions, and a comment:
1. Do all the BobCats that are experiencing "mushiness" of the elevator have the recommended 1 3/4" travel ?
Everyone is talking about ATV, but I have seen nothing about actual measured travel, aside from Tony F. who gave his measurements in degrees.
2. Dennis said "I had so much elevator throw I thought it should snap really well if full stick was given." (post #30)
Do you recall if you had a measured 1 3/4" of travel, or did you set the travel to a lower "more conservative" amount?
3. Todd said "My linkage is exactly like Davids above, as always...I try to get throw required at 100% atv." (post #31)
Did you have to deviate from the BVM suggested set up to accomplish this? It has been my experience that when the suggested servo arm is installed, 140 - 150% ATV is necessary to produce the required elevator travel.
4. Did the BobCats that crashed have any problems pulling up after a high speed pass?
David said "Vernon and I were flying formation at the time we both went into the loop at a relatively high speed, roughly 180-200 mph. We both throttled back as we approached the top of the loop" (post #26)
If the servo in Vernon's BobCat wasn't powerful enough it should have never pulled into a loop to begin with. However coming down the backside of a loop it would not be difficult to over-speed the Elevator and reduce it's effectiveness.
